Description

'History of Corn Milling' by Richard Bennett delves into the historical evolution of milling practices in various regions, from the Isle of Man to Norway, Scotland, and Roumania. The book explores the use of Norse mills, regulations governing trade guilds in ancient Rome, and the Domesday Survey's insights into milling resources in England. It also discusses the transition of milling rights in medieval England and the legal disputes surrounding causeways, dams, and mills. With a focus on historical developments and technological advancements, the book provides a comprehensive overview of the cultural and economic significance of milling throughout history.
